What changed on 9 September 2026?

The Ministry of Education made the fully updated Science and Social Sciences learning areas available for Years 0 to 10. The Science material sits on Tāhūrangi, the Ministry's curriculum platform.

The release gives schools, kura, teachers, parents and education providers a final national reference point. It replaces the uncertainty that comes with working from drafts or partial releases.

What was released What it covers What it means
Updated Science learning area Years 0 to 10 The full science progression is available to use and plan from
Updated Social Sciences learning area Years 0 to 10 The full social sciences progression is available alongside Science
Implementation guidance Schools and kura The Ministry has set different starting points across year levels and learning areas

The release is not a single worksheet or one fixed order of lessons. A curriculum defines what students should know and be able to do. Schools, educators and tutoring services still decide how to explain, practise and apply that content.

The New Zealand science curriculum timeline

There are several dates in the official announcement, and they do not all mean the same thing.

9 September 2026: the curriculum is available

All Years 0 to 10 Science content is available. This is the release date that gives families and education providers the complete, updated reference.

2027: schools and kura begin using the new Science content

The Ministry says schools and kura are expected to start using Years 0 to 10 Science and Social Sciences from 2027. Years 9 and 10 content across all learning areas is also expected to begin from the start of 2027.

2027 and 2028: implementation continues

Schools and kura have 2027 and 2028 to fully implement the updated Science and Social Sciences learning areas. That gives education communities time to update planning, resources and classroom practice.

2029: other remaining Years 0 to 8 content begins

The Ministry says all remaining Years 0 to 8 curriculum content is expected to start being used from 2029. This refers to the wider staged curriculum rollout. It does not change the 2027 starting point stated for the updated Science learning area.

1. Start with your student's current year and understanding

Year level gives you a curriculum reference, but it should not force a student past an unfinished foundation. Check what your student can explain, not only what they have previously covered.

Look for three things:

  • ideas they can explain in their own words
  • ideas they recognise but cannot apply
  • earlier concepts that still cause confusion

2. Use the curriculum as a map, not a daily script

A curriculum shows the knowledge and capabilities to build. It does not require every student to take the same route at the same speed.

Keep the destination visible, then adjust the journey. A student who needs more time on one concept is not failing the curriculum. They are building the foundation needed for the next step.

3. Connect science to genuine interests

Science becomes easier to discuss when the question matters to the student. Weather, animals, sport, cooking, machines, oceans and space can all create useful starting points.

The interest is the doorway, not a replacement for the curriculum. Tia uses student interests to make the explanation more relevant while keeping the lesson tied to the required science content.

4. Ask for evidence of understanding

Finishing a lesson is not the same as understanding it. Ask the student to explain the idea, apply it to a new example or show why an answer makes sense.

Useful checks include:

  • explaining a process without copying the wording
  • predicting what will happen and giving a reason
  • interpreting a simple table, diagram or result
  • comparing two explanations using evidence
  • identifying what new information would change a conclusion
